The Brief

Law firms have a branding problem. Most either lean so hard into tradition that they disappear into a sea of identical serif logos and navy blue websites, or they over-correct into a sleek minimalism that strips out the gravitas the industry demands. Leo Law needed something different a visual identity that commands the room without sacrificing warmth, and a website that converts prospects into clients from the first scroll.

The concept had to work across a full-service firm spanning Family & Divorce Law, Criminal Defense, Corporate & Business Law, Real Estate Litigation, Personal Injury, Banking Law, Education Law, and Markets & Securities. Every practice area different. One brand that holds them all.

What We Built

Logo Design

The Leo Law mark centres on a regal lion holding the scales of justice a symbol that does double work. The lion speaks to strength, courage, and the relentless advocacy every client deserves. The scales ground it in law and balance. Rendered in gold on deep navy, the mark carries the weight of a firm that has been trusted for decades, even for a firm just beginning to build that reputation.

The circular badge format with the firm name and "Attorneys at Law" set in classic capital serif gives the logo the kind of timeless authority that works on letterheads, courtroom briefs, digital headers, and embossed business cards without losing a single point of impact.

Colour & Typography System

The palette is built around deep navy and burnished gold colours that have communicated prestige in the legal world for a reason, but executed here with precision rather than default. Dark backgrounds elevate the gold to something that feels earned. Typography pairs a commanding serif display face with clean, readable body copy so the site feels both weighty and effortlessly navigable.

Web Design Concept

The homepage opens with a bold editorial statement: "Justice Is Not A Privilege. It's Your Right." a headline designed to stop a prospective client mid-scroll and make them feel seen. The hero section layers Lady Justice imagery behind the type, creating depth and gravitas without clutter.

Below the fold, the site architecture is deliberate. Practice area cards give every service its own clear identity while keeping the visual system cohesive. The "Why Choose LeoLaw" section built on trust, results, and integrity gives prospects the reassurance they need before they commit to a consultation. Stats (25+ years active, 1,240+ cases won, 98% success rate) are surfaced prominently because in legal, credibility is the conversion tool.

The firm profile section introduces Michael Phillips, Senior Partner & Founder, with photography and a personal statement because people hire lawyers, not law firms, and the site needed to reflect that. A "Transparent Pricing" callout and a persistent Free Consultation CTA remove the two biggest barriers to contact in the legal sector: fear of the unknown and fear of the cost.

The scrolling practice area marquee at the base of the hero keeps the firm's full scope visible without requiring a separate page every practice area is a searchable keyword, every one is a signal to a prospective client that Leo Law handles exactly what they're dealing with.
